Overview

A driver with a full UK manual licence is required for this role!

About the role: This service is home to 5 gentlemen, ages range from 21 to 65. There are a variety of support needs including PEG, Epilepsy, wheelchair and hoist use as well as personal care.

Successful applicants will receive a full training package and the opportunity to undertake apprenticeships or gain further qualifications. The gentlemen here enjoy a range of activities including golf, bowling, aromatherapy, theatre trips, pantos, pub lunches, cinema, walking, gardening, shopping.

The focus of this role is to help the people we support to develop independent living skills: improve their personal hygiene, assist with meal preparation, exercise, leisure activities and socialising – the daily routine of regular life. You’ll get huge job satisfaction from seeing the people you are supporting do more for themselves and live the life they want to live. If you’re interested in building a career, we’re here to support you all the way on your own journey.

The staff working here said: "A good sense of humour needed but it is a rewarding, happy place to work, with a nice environment, and friendly".

Choice Support is Disability Confident which is a scheme run by the Department of Work and Pensions. As part of our commitment, we operate a guaranteed interview scheme - all candidates who declare a disability and meet the essential criteria for the role will be guaranteed an interview.
